Veritel Screen Saver User Guide
Release Version 1.0 (January 20, 1999)

Product Introduction

The Veritel Screen Saver is a voice identity protected
screen saver program for the Windows 95 and 98 operating
systems. Unlike regular password protected screen savers,
this screen saver will ask the user to answer some
challenging questions, and match the user's voice with
a pre-recorded voice sample for identity verification,
before the normal screen will resume.

Voice verification provides a more secure alternative
to conventional passwords, which can be stolen, lost
or forgotten.

The user can configure alternative security options,
like user profile questions, one time passwords, etc,
so that the legitimate user can safely return to the
normal screen if the user is unable to voice verify
due to laryngitis or some other unforeseen occurrence.

Audio configuration:

There is an "Audio Configuration" button in the
screen saver configuration dialog box. You need
to go through the audio configuration procedure
before doing other configurations. This procedure
determines that your audio recording and playback
devices are working properly, and helps you to
set the microphone volume level properly. Once
you have done the audio configuration, the proper
audio settings will be remembered and you do not
need to repeat it in the future.

Enrolling your voice:

You have to enroll your voice samples before the voice
protection function of the Veritel Screen Saver can be used.
Click on the "Add User" button, entering a new user name
(Please note: User names must contain letters and numbers
only).  Click on the "Start Enrolling" button to begin the
voice enrollment process.

The voice enrollment process may take a few minutes and you
will be asked a total of 20 questions.  Try to answer all
questions in a regular and consistent manner.

User Security Settings:

The User Security Settings dialog box allows you to change
the voice verification threshold and test your voice against
the threshold. It will also allow you to set up alternative
ways to pass the identity verification process, including
the User Profile Questions, in case you are unable to verify
using your voice. It is recommended that you configure a few
User Profile Questions and provide answers, so that you will
not end up being locked out of your computer.

The User Security Settings contains two pages: the User
Authentication Settings and the Alternative Settings.
They are explained below.

Voice Authentication Settings:

After voice enrollment, you may press the "Test Voice" button
to do a voice verification test. You may adjust the security
threshold accordingly if you pass the test with a score much
higher than the threshold, or if you fail the test by scoring
below the threshold. Recommended setting of the threshold is
60, the "Default Threshold".

You may also set the number of "Valid Inputs" needed to pass
the voice verification process.  The minimum number is 1 and
the maximum is 4, which means you will have to successfully
answer the specified number of questions to voice verify.

Alternate Settings:

There are three checkboxes you will need to set in the Alternate
Authentication Settings of the Veritel Screen Saver.  You must
click on the OK button after you finish to save the changes.
If you click on the cancel button, the setup screen exits
without saving the changes.

The three checkboxes are described below:

Enable Use of User Profile Questions - Allows you to provide
manually entered answers to at least four questions using the
"User Profile" window.  These questions will provide the
secondary means of accessing your computer in the case voice
verification cannot be used.  Steps to complete "User Profile":

1) Put a check in the box next to the question you want to answer.

2) Enter the answer to each question as it is displayed. You
can enter up to 15 characters for each answer.

3) To go back and change an answer after you have entered it,
click the "Edit" button.

4) To create your own User Profile Questions, click the "New"
button.

Enable One Time Password - Use password in addition to voice
verification - By checking the "Enable One Time Password"
button, the Veritel Screen Saver will create a one time
password, which is good for only one use.  Once you login
with this password, another password must be issued to login
with a one time password again.  This is intended only as a
backup to the voice verification method.

Security Options:
 
Lock out Account - Allows you to lock up your computer (you
can specify the lock out time period) if a user fails to
voice verify after a predetermined number of attempts (you
can specify the number of attempts).

Hide-User ID - Allows you to hide the user name that is
entered into the User Administration box.

Voiceprint Management:

This feature allows you to re-enroll and/or update your voiceprint 
and can be activated by clicking on the Voiceprint Management 
button on the configuration dialog box.

You may choose to re-enroll if you wish to change your answers
to any of the questions. You may choose to update your voiceprint
if you feel that your verification success rate has dropped 
significantly. As opposed to re-enrolling, you will be asked each 
of the five questions only once.

Activation of Veritel Screen Saver:

The Veritel Screen Saver can be activated under two separate 
circumstances. It can be activated by simply double clicking on 
the Veritel Screen Saver shortcut that is placed on your desktop.  
It can also be activated by setting it as the default screen saver 
and allowing for the user-designated idle time to pass.

Pass the Veritel Screen Saver protection:

If you attempt to deactivate the Veritel Screen Saver by
mouse or keyboard activity, a voice verification screen will
pop up and the legitimate user will have to voice verify to
get back to the regular screen.

The Veritel Screen Saver will begin voice verification
immediately, using the same username as last used.  If the
voice verification is successful, the regular screen resumes.
If voice verification fails, a "Use Password" button shows up,
allowing you the option of either attempting voice verification
again, or if you checked the "Allow Password" checkbox during
set up, you may use the manually entered password.
